Output af3313f19a692d5f428cba6a3d04f569779d2619388bb41453eda8126777d102:24

value
15330570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703191b80a42b1c2fe4af717a1645fb01b8d750d OP_EQUAL
address
MJ8PJ3YGzoSx4YfyZwjN2kQqtFYDkuvLCE
transaction
af3313f19a692d5f428cba6a3d04f569779d2619388bb41453eda8126777d102
spent
true